C

Carolyn Burke

10 几个月前

IDF never disappoints! Their dehydrated food produ...

IDF never disappoints! Their dehydrated food products are of the highest quality, and the taste is always amazing. I love how easy it is to order from their website idf.com. The customer service is excellent too. Highly recommend IDF for all your dehydrated food needs.

注释:

暂无评论